Abstract

Employers of foundry industries are constantly encountered with impediments with regards to employee turnover and formulation of structured behavioural process at work place. The study focuses on formulating parameters pertaining to competency mapping and employee engagement. Further the competency mapping parameters relationship with employee engagement is assessed through formulation of research model. It was found that competency mapping practices influence in efficient employee engagement at foundry industries but at Belgaum foundry industries employers need to focus on knowledge and skills development. The proposed model holds good and has therelevant scope of inference provided all the elements constituting construct are inculcated amidst day today work environment of the employers. Knowledge and skills are what the employers of foundry industries at Belgaum are lagging bases the study and the sustainable growth and performance can be enhanced through these parameters.
